Giving Profile

In 2025, Melvin and Geraldine Hoven Foundation based in CA paid 22 grants totaling $321K to 22 organizations across 5 states. Individual grants ranged from $2K to $70K, with a median of $5K. Its largest recipients included Michael J Fox Foundation, Post, and Second Harvest Food Bank. The foundation does not accept unsolicited applications — giving is by invitation only.
